Fibroblast dynamics as an in vitro screening platform for anti-fibrotic drugs in primary myelofibrosis.

Although the cause for bone marrow fibrosis in patients with myelofibrosis remains controversial, it has been hypothesized that it is caused by extensive fibroblast proliferation under the influence of cytokines generated by the malignant megakaryocytes.
